French mining solutions are no longer just about raw computational power. Instead, they focus heavily on optimizing energy consumption and deploying sophisticated hosting infrastructures that ensure miners run cooler, greener, and leaner. Recent data from the International Energy Agency (IEA) confirms that France’s mining farms have achieved an average 30% reduction in carbon footprint compared to 2024 metrics, thanks to innovative energy recovery systems and strategic utilization of hydropower and nuclear-generated electricity.
Take, for instance, the case of the Nouvelle-Aquitaine Mining Farm, where smart energy grids dynamically adjust power allocation based on real-time demand and Bitcoin price volatility. This machinery symphony doesn’t just crank hashes blindly; it orchestrates every watt consumed to maximize returns under fluctuating crypto market conditions—a feat that draws both miners and investors seeking resilience against wild price swings.
But crypto miners aren’t just after returns—they crave security and uptime amidst surging network difficulties on BTC, ETH, and emerging altcoins like DOGE. French mining rigs are integrating AI-driven predictive maintenance systems that remotely scan hardware for thermal anomalies and wear, drastically reducing downtime. For example, MinerTech Lyon has reported a 15% increase in miner lifespan through such proactive diagnostics, translating directly into operational stability.

In this age of evolving protocols, French hosting providers aren’t just vending space to dump rigs—they offer full-spectrum service alternatively dubbed “mining rig concierge.” They handle everything from hardware procurement, firmware updates, cooling system calibrations, to energy billing. This integrated approach empowers miners to concentrate on strategic decisions without sweating over the nuts and bolts. Such hosting models are increasingly attractive to institutional players eyeing BTC mining without the headache of setup and maintenance, aligning perfectly with trends highlighted by the Global Crypto Council’s 2025 Mining Infrastructure Report.
